Cannabis, a Natural Therapy

Nowadays Cannabis is the subject of endless debates and discussions, and opinions differ. Fact is that Cannabis has been used for therapeutical and medicinal reasons ancient times. Throughout history, we see that several societies used Cannabis for treatments. Whether it was as an anti-inflammatory, painkiller or anti-pyretic, Cannabis was always seen as a natural medicine. Shamans consumed cannabis before starting special ceremonies, to make contact with spirits from the other world. Currently, scientists are doing a lot of investigation on the positive effects of Cannabis for treatment of certain diseases. But experts warn about abuse, since consumption might cause a serious addiction. Therefore consumption is prohibited in most countries, although sometimes there is made an exception for medical therapies. To continue with the investigations in an efficient way, scientists should have easier access to cannabis. But because of the illegality of the substance in many countries, investigations drag on very long, which raises the cost significant. This is a serious problem which makes investigators lose valuable time and influences the relevancy of the results. However, politicians are more willing to collaborate with scientific projects, as well as many governments who seek to provide more support in this matter. General opinion is depending much on the country and society. Spain for example, is pretty open-minded and tolerant about the consumption of Cannabis. In Catalonia in particular there are many actions to attempt the legalization of cannabis for medical purposes. The most impresive park of Rome – Villa Borghese

Rome is a beautiful and charming city with endless things to see. In fact, many people consider it a veritable outdoor museum. So much beauty will leave many people with open mouths… In the Eternal City all your wishes will come true if you simply toss a coin into the Trevi Fountain. But from all its landmarks, there is one that you should not miss: the beautiful Villa Borghese. The Villa Borghese is the Rome´s lung. This is a huge park located in the heart of the city, endowed with vast gardens, fountains, lakes, elegant green areas and some small building. Do you want to enjoy a great day enjoying a mix of nature and art? The Villa Borghese Park is the most indicated place. Among the most popular areas of the park, which has up to 9 innings, there are the Trinità dei Monti staircase, the Porta Pinciana, the monumental entrance to Piazzale Flaminio and the Piazza del Popolo in Pincio, where the “Giardino del Pincio” is located and where there are incredible views of the city. One of the most significant buildings in the park is the Borghese Gallety in Villa Giulia, built between 1551 y1555, as a summer residence of Pope Julius the Third, and which today houses the National Etruscan Museum. The Viale delle Belle Arti building was built for the famous International Rome Art Exhibitionin in1911, because of the first anniversary of the Italian Reunification. Madrid and its wonderful gastronomy

Is lunchtime getting closer and you are already starving? If this is the case, there’s no better way for satisfying your hunger pains than with some Spanish food which is also famous for being healthy. So now you’re asking yourself with which delicious dish you should start, right? It’s actually quiet easy: you should just dedicate your time to the amazing gastronomy of Madrid. Due to the geographical location of Spain’s capital in the heart of the country, its gastronomy is influenced by many different regions. Nevertheless Madrid’s cuisine enjoys a really particular character. Especially, the squid sandwiches belong to its culinary highlights. The emigrants who came from other Spanish regions to Madrid, have transformed the gastronomy of the city into a perfect mixture of the most different recipes and tastes with an interesting Hispanic and Roman touch. But the environmental circumstances exert a certain influence to Madrid’s gastronomy. So in summer they mainly eat cold dishes, like the delicious chickpeas vinaigrettes or in winter you enjoy warm dishes and soups. Who hasn’t heard of the famous Spanish tapas? Madrid belongs to the centre of the tapas-bars meanwhile those little tasty appetizers are popular in the whole country. The main ingredients of the tapas are for example cheese, sausages and seafood. But this is only the basis, because you will enjoy a huge variety of all different kinds of tapas: octopus, Spanish omelets, vinegar anchovies, squid, pig’s ear, croquettes, etc..
